DateTimePicker.MinDate-Eigenschaft
Ruft die minimalen Datums- und Uhrzeitangaben ab, die im Steuerelement ausgewählt werden können, oder legt diese fest.
Namespace: System.Windows.Forms
Assembly: System.Windows.Forms (in system.windows.forms.dll)
Syntax
'Declaration
Public Property MinDate As DateTime
'Usage
Dim instance As DateTimePicker
Dim value As DateTime
value = instance.MinDate
instance.MinDate = value
public DateTime MinDate { get; set; }
public:
property DateTime MinDate {
DateTime get ();
void set (DateTime value);
}
/** @property */
public DateTime get_MinDate ()
/** @property */
public void set_MinDate (DateTime value)
public function get MinDate () : DateTime
public function set MinDate (value : DateTime)
Eigenschaftenwert
Die minimalen Datums- und Uhrzeitangaben, die im Steuerelement ausgewählt werden können. Die Standardeinstellung ist 1.1.1753, 00:00:00.
Ausnahmen
Ausnahmetyp | Bedingung |
---|---|
Der zugewiesene Wert ist nicht kleiner als der MaxDate-Wert. |
|
Der zugewiesene Wert ist kleiner als der MinDateTime-Wert. |
Beispiel
Im folgenden Codebeispiel wird eine neue Instanz eines DateTimePicker-Steuerelements erstellt und initialisiert. Die CustomFormat-Eigenschaft des Steuerelements ist festgelegt. Außerdem ist die ShowCheckBox-Eigenschaft festgelegt, sodass im Steuerelement eine CheckBox angezeigt wird, wie auch die ShowUpDown-Eigenschaft, sodass das Steuerelement als Drehfeldsteuerelement (auch als Auf-Ab-Steuerelement bezeichnet) angezeigt wird.
Public Sub CreateMyDateTimePicker()
' Create a new DateTimePicker control and initialize it.
Dim dateTimePicker1 As New DateTimePicker()
' Set the MinDate and MaxDate.
dateTimePicker1.MinDate = New DateTime(1985, 6, 20)
dateTimePicker1.MaxDate = DateTime.Today
' Set the CustomFormat string.
dateTimePicker1.CustomFormat = "MMMM dd, yyyy - dddd"
dateTimePicker1.Format = DateTimePickerFormat.Custom
' Show the CheckBox and display the control as an up-down control.
dateTimePicker1.ShowCheckBox = True
dateTimePicker1.ShowUpDown = True
End Sub 'CreateMyDateTimePicker
public void CreateMyDateTimePicker()
{
// Create a new DateTimePicker control and initialize it.
DateTimePicker dateTimePicker1 = new DateTimePicker();
// Set the MinDate and MaxDate.
dateTimePicker1.MinDate = new DateTime(1985, 6, 20);
dateTimePicker1.MaxDate = DateTime.Today;
// Set the CustomFormat string.
dateTimePicker1.CustomFormat = "MMMM dd, yyyy - dddd";
dateTimePicker1.Format = DateTimePickerFormat.Custom;
// Show the CheckBox and display the control as an up-down control.
dateTimePicker1.ShowCheckBox = true;
dateTimePicker1.ShowUpDown = true;
}
public:
void CreateMyDateTimePicker()
{
// Create a new DateTimePicker control and initialize it.
DateTimePicker^ dateTimePicker1 = gcnew DateTimePicker;
// Set the MinDate and MaxDate.
dateTimePicker1->MinDate = DateTime(1985,6,20);
dateTimePicker1->MaxDate = DateTime::Today;
// Set the CustomFormat string.
dateTimePicker1->CustomFormat = "MMMM dd, yyyy - dddd";
dateTimePicker1->Format = DateTimePickerFormat::Custom;
// Show the CheckBox and display the control as an up-down control.
dateTimePicker1->ShowCheckBox = true;
dateTimePicker1->ShowUpDown = true;
}
public void CreateMyDateTimePicker()
{
// Create a new DateTimePicker control and initialize it.
DateTimePicker dateTimePicker1 = new DateTimePicker();
// Set the MinDate and MaxDate.
dateTimePicker1.set_MinDate(new DateTime(1985, 6, 20));
dateTimePicker1.set_MaxDate(DateTime.get_Today());
// Set the CustomFormat string.
dateTimePicker1.set_CustomFormat("MMMM dd, yyyy - dddd");
dateTimePicker1.set_Format(DateTimePickerFormat.Custom);
// Show the CheckBox and display the control as an up-down control.
dateTimePicker1.set_ShowCheckBox(true);
dateTimePicker1.set_ShowUpDown(true);
} //CreateMyDateTimePicker
Plattformen
Windows 98, Windows 2000 SP4, Windows CE, Windows Millennium Edition, Windows Mobile für Pocket PC, Windows Mobile für Smartphone,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
.NET Framework unterstützt nicht alle Versionen sämtlicher Plattformen. Eine Liste der unterstützten Versionen finden Sie unter Systemanforderungen.
Versionsinformationen
.NET Framework
Unterstützt in: 2.0, 1.1, 1.0
.NET Compact Framework
Unterstützt in: 2.0
Siehe auch
Referenz
DateTimePicker-Klasse
DateTimePicker-Member
System.Windows.Forms-Namespace
MinDateTime
DateTimePicker.MaxDate-Eigenschaft